This is a lovely example of a limestone (not marble) Rococo church built in the 19th century (completed in 1894). The original plan was to build it in marble but the cost was prohibitive so they used limestone instead and made a lovely job of it. The highlight is the interior…

A beautiful church, with its dome visible over most of Copenhagen. Inside, you'll find a circular interior, a bit different form most churches in the country. Also a bit darker than other churches, due to the rather small windows positioned rather high up around the huge hall.…
